Unlike synthetic alternatives, genuine Jadeite exhibits a unique “inner glow”—a light-scattering property inherent to its pyroxene-group structure that cannot be replicated by polymer-impregnated (Type-B) or dyed (Type-C) counterfeits.
This “inner glow,” technically referred to as the tian-cui or “field-emerald” effect, is the result of the stone’s complex microcrystalline interlocking texture. Under high-magnification forensic inspection, Type-A Jadeite displays a granular, heterogeneous structure that refracts light in a non-linear, randomized pattern. This is a direct consequence of the stone’s formation in deep-crust subduction zones, where the high-pressure environment forces the sodium-aluminum silicate fibers into a chaotic, densely packed arrangement. In contrast, B-type or C-type counterfeits rely on polymer resins to fill microscopic surface fissures and voids. Under specialized lab techniques, these resinous fillers create “dead zones” where the expected light scattering is dampened or entirely absent. The Forensic Distinction: Jadeite vs. Nephrite
Institutional investors often confuse the market position of Jadeite with Nephrite. While both are colloquially “jade,” their actuarial profiles are distinct. Nephrite, an amphibole-group silicate, is significantly more abundant and polishes to a resinous luster. Jadeite, a sodium-aluminum silicate of the pyroxene family, requires extreme tectonic pressure (HP-LT conditions) to form. Nephrite is characterized by its interlocking, fibrous, felt-like structure, which grants it remarkable toughness—often exceeding that of diamond in terms of resistance to shattering. However, in terms of refractive index and potential for gemological rarity, it remains fundamentally anchored to the decorative art sector. Jadeite, conversely, possesses a pyroxene lattice that allows for a much higher degree of translucency, and in its most prized “Imperial” variety, it achieves a color saturation directly competitive with the finest emeralds. Nephrite deposits are geographically widespread, found in significant quantities across China, Canada, and Russia, which creates a lower floor for market pricing. Jadeite production is hyper-localized, with gem-quality material predominantly sourced from highly volatile nodes in Myanmar.
